Nestled in the heart of Sheboygan County, Elkhart Lake, Wisconsin, is a picturesque village known for its serene beauty and welcoming community. With a population of just over a thousand residents, this charming locale offers a tranquil escape from the hustle and bustle of city life. The village's namesake, Elkhart Lake, is a stunning body of water that draws visitors and locals alike for its crystal-clear waters and scenic surroundings.

Elkhart Lake is a haven for tourists, offering a variety of attractions that cater to diverse interests. The area is renowned for its motorsport heritage, with Road America, a world-class race track, providing thrilling experiences for racing enthusiasts. For those seeking a more laid-back experience, the village boasts several spas, boutique shops, and fine dining establishments that highlight the region's culinary prowess. Outdoor enthusiasts can explore the numerous parks and trails that offer opportunities for hiking, biking, and bird watching.

This idyllic setting is particularly suitable for seniors, offering a peaceful environment with a strong sense of community. The village's small size fosters close-knit relationships among residents, while its array of leisure activities ensures that seniors can remain active and engaged. The natural beauty and clean air contribute to a healthy lifestyle, making Elkhart Lake an attractive destination for retirees seeking a serene place to call home.

Assisted Living Costs in Elkhart Lake, Wisconsin

When considering assisted living options in Elkhart Lake, Wisconsin, understanding the associated costs is crucial for effective planning. The region offers a range of facilities catering to various needs, with the median monthly cost of assisted living in Wisconsin being approximately $5,500. However, Elkhart Lake provides a more affordable option, with costs averaging around $4,088 per month, making it an attractive choice for many families seeking quality care without the higher price tag.

Elkhart Lake's proximity to several reputable hospitals, such as St. Nicholas Hospital, Aurora Valley View Medical Center, HSHS St. Vincent Hospital, and HSHS St. Nicholas Hospital, ensures that residents have access to comprehensive medical care when needed. This accessibility is a significant factor for families prioritizing health and wellness in their decision-making process.

In terms of financial assistance, Wisconsin offers several government support programs to help mitigate the costs of assisted living. These programs may include Medicaid waivers and other state-funded initiatives designed to support seniors and their families. It's advisable for prospective residents and their families to explore these options to determine eligibility and potential benefits.

Assisted Living vs Memory Care vs Nursing Home vs Independent Living in Elkhart Lake, Wisconsin

When considering senior living options in Elkhart Lake, Wisconsin, it's essential to understand the differences between assisted living, memory care, nursing homes, and independent living facilities. Each offers unique benefits tailored to varying needs and lifestyles.

Assisted living facilities provide a blend of independence and support, ideal for seniors who need help with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, or medication management but still wish to maintain an active lifestyle. These communities often offer a range of social activities and amenities, fostering a sense of community and engagement among residents.

Memory care is a specialized form of assisted living designed for individuals with Alzheimer's disease or other forms of dementia. These facilities provide a safe and structured environment with specially trained staff to support residents' unique cognitive and emotional needs. Memory care communities focus on enhancing quality of life through tailored programs and activities that promote mental stimulation and social interaction.

Nursing homes, or skilled nursing facilities, offer the highest level of care for seniors who require medical attention and assistance with most daily activities. These facilities are equipped to handle complex health needs, providing 24-hour medical supervision and rehabilitation services. Nursing homes are suitable for individuals recovering from surgery, dealing with chronic illnesses, or requiring long-term care.

Independent living is geared towards seniors who are self-sufficient but prefer a community setting that offers convenience and social opportunities. These facilities provide private residences along with access to communal amenities such as dining, fitness centers, and recreational activities. Independent living is perfect for those who want to enjoy a maintenance-free lifestyle while staying socially active.

Choosing the right option in Elkhart Lake depends on the individual's health needs, lifestyle preferences, and desired level of independence. Each facility type offers distinct advantages, ensuring that seniors can find a community that best suits their needs and enhances their quality of life.

How to Qualify for Assisted Living in Elkhart Lake, Wisconsin

Qualifying for assisted living in Elkhart Lake, Wisconsin, involves several considerations, including health assessments, financial evaluations, and specific residency requirements. Understanding these criteria can help you or your loved one navigate the transition smoothly.

Firstly, potential residents typically undergo a health assessment to determine the level of care required. This assessment evaluates daily living activities such as bathing, dressing, and medication management. A physician or a licensed healthcare professional usually conducts the evaluation, ensuring that the services provided align with the individual's needs.

Financial eligibility is another crucial factor. Assisted living can be costly, so assessing your financial situation is essential. In Wisconsin, individuals may qualify for financial assistance through government programs such as Medicaid or the Family Care Program. These programs help cover the costs of assisted living for those who meet specific income and asset limits. It is advisable to contact the Wisconsin Department of Health Services or a local Medicaid office to understand the eligibility criteria and application process.

Residency requirements may also apply. Some facilities in Elkhart Lake may prioritize local residents or have specific criteria related to the length of time you have lived in the area. It's beneficial to contact the facilities directly to understand their specific policies.

For those seeking assistance with the application process, consider reaching out to local senior centers or advocacy groups in Elkhart Lake. These organizations often provide valuable resources and guidance to help navigate the complexities of qualifying for assisted living.

The concept of assisted living emerged in the 1980s as a response to the growing demand for more personalized and less institutionalized care for the elderly. It was developed as an alternative to traditional nursing homes, which often provided a more clinical environment. Assisted living facilities aim to create a homelike atmosphere, where residents can enjoy privacy and autonomy while having access to necessary support services.

Costs for assisted living can vary widely based on location, level of care, and amenities offered. On average, monthly expenses can range from $3,000 to $6,000. These costs typically cover housing, meals, housekeeping, transportation, and a variety of social activities. Some facilities may offer additional services such as memory care or specialized medical attention, which can increase the overall cost.

Assisted living facilities provide a range of care options, including personal care assistance, medication management, and support with activities of daily living (ADLs) such as bathing, dressing, and eating. Many facilities also offer social and recreational activities to promote engagement and community building among residents.

To qualify for assisted living, individuals generally need to demonstrate a need for assistance with ADLs but do not require the intensive medical care provided by nursing homes. Assessments are typically conducted to evaluate the level of care needed and to ensure that the facility can adequately meet the resident's needs.
